How can technology help in managing such situation?

All networks, mobile as well as fixed, are dimensioned to handle the peak load during the busiest hour of the week. The fact that people are staying home during the entire day has not changed this although the load has increased during daytime. What is the latest technology that will change the world and how can countries and organisations leverage the technology?

When looking at the development in this industry over the last few years it is truly astonishing to see the progress. 5G is the next generation of wireless technology and is key to empowering new services and use cases for people, businesses, and society at large. Previous generations were centred around consumer and personal communications. 5G will serve consumers, enterprises and take the internet of things to a next level, where superior connectivity is a prerequisite. The 5G specifications were accelerated in 3GPP, leading to device and infrastructure vendors taking on the challenge to deliver 5G earlier than expected. It is encouraging to see that 5G now has broad support from almost all device makers, and a very strong ecosystem. So far, a majority of the launch markets are charging a premium averaging almost 20 per cent for 5G subscriptions. Today most of the investments, traffic and subscriptions are in 2G, 3G or 4G networks. Modernizing existing networks, improving network performance and increasing user experience, continue to be at the core of every service provider’s day-to-day business. By 2025, we expect 5G to have 2.6 billion subscriptions covering up to 65 per cent of the world’s population and generating 45 per cent of the world’s total mobile data traffic.

One major challenge of tech startups is lack of funding. How can African startups get access to funding to promote their business?
The development of Long Term Evolution (LTE) technology and 5G digital infrastructure is an integral part of Africa’s growing economy and has proved to be an essential driver of an inclusive information society that integrates digitization in all critical aspects of life, such as education, transport, health, energy and even homeland security. All of this, of course, carries significant potential to contribute to the UN’s Sustainable Development Goals (SDGs) in Africa. From an Ericsson perspective, we support startups through Ericsson Ventures; an entity that invests in companies with focus on emerging growth areas for Ericsson, Ericsson customers, as well Ericsson core businesses. Ericsson Ventures invests across all stages with focus on sectors aligned to the core business of Ericsson. Areas of focus range from radio technology to IoT, AI, software defined networking, analytics, connected cars, security, wireless, mobile advertising and Augmented Reality (AR) and Virtual Reality (VR). Having a stage agnostic approach, Ericsson Ventures invests in every early stage company the closer the company is to Ericsson’s core business, whilst opting for a mature company, with proven track record, existing products and a solid track of high revenue generation, the further the company is from Ericsson’s core business.
